二級造遊樂船操作人(遊艇) 牌照分為兩部份。甲部是船長職能,乙部是輪機知識。只有筆試,沒有海試。執照可駕駛50呎長及無動力限制的所有香港遊艇。考試在香港海事處舉行。最快一個月內取得執照。執照是永久免牌費,有效期到65歲,驗眼合格後、身體適合者可以免費續牌。
課程方面,每部份上四堂,共八堂,一星期上兩晚,四個星期內完成。
甲部內容包括國際避碰規則、本地海事條例、海圖應用、船舶特性、燈號旗號、及船長必修科目。
乙部內容包括二衝程及四衝程電油、柴油船隻引擎原理、燃燒系統、電路裝置、傳動系統、損壞原因、維修方法及各項必考輪機科目。

由2023年4月4日起,考試已交由高峰進修學院辦理;可以分開報考。當甲、乙兩個部份合格後,須親身到海事處申請換領正式遊樂船操作人執照。
